Silver-Mediated Radical Cyclization of Alkynoates and α‑Keto Acids Leading to Coumarins via Cascade Double C–C Bond Formation

A novel and convenient silver-mediated radical cyclization method for the synthesis of coumarin derivatives via the direct difunctionalization of alkynoates with α-keto acids through double C–C bond formation under mild conditions has been developed. This new method is highly efficient and practical, and the starting materials are readily prepared. The present method should provide a useful strategy for the construction of coumarin motifs.

本研究开发了一种新颖便捷的银介导自由基环化(radical cyclization)方法,可在温和条件下,通过炔酸酯(alkynoates)与α-酮酸(α-keto acids)的直接双官能团化反应,经双重C-C键形成过程合成香豆素衍生物(coumarin derivatives)。该方法高效实用,且起始原料易于制备,可为香豆素骨架的构建提供一条实用策略。
